ZIP 00705 and ZIP 00707 are ZIP Code areas in Puerto Rico.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

ZIP 00705 has the higher population (24,475 vs 10,400 in ZIP 00707). ZIP 00705 has the higher median household income ($21,806 vs $19,173 in ZIP 00707). ZIP 00705 has the higher median home value ($120,700 vs $106,300 in ZIP 00707).
